Chimney inspection services involve a thorough examination of a chimney’s interior and exterior components to identify potential issues. Professionals typically use specialized tools and techniques to check for blockages, creosote buildup, cracks, or damage to the flue, chimney liner, and masonry. This process helps ensure that the chimney is functioning properly and safely, reducing the risk of fire hazards or carbon monoxide leaks. Regular inspections are recommended for maintaining the overall health of a chimney and preventing costly repairs down the line.
One of the primary benefits of chimney inspections is the early detection of problems that could compromise safety or efficiency. For example, a cracked or damaged chimney liner can allow dangerous gases to escape into the home, while blockages caused by debris or animal nests can prevent proper venting. Addressing these issues promptly with the help of a professional can prevent more serious, expensive repairs and promote safer use of fireplaces, wood stoves, or heating systems that rely on chimneys.
Chimney inspection services are commonly used for a variety of property types, including residential homes, historic houses, and commercial buildings with fireplaces or heating appliances. Homeowners preparing for the winter season or those experiencing drafts, smoke backflow, or odors often seek inspections. Additionally, properties that have not been inspected in several years or have recently undergone renovations may benefit from a professional assessment to ensure the chimney remains in good condition.

Inspection Costs - The typical cost for a chimney inspection ranges from $100 to $300, depending on the complexity of the assessment and local rates. For example, a basic visual inspection in Burleson, TX, might be around $125. More detailed inspections with additional testing can increase the price.
Service Fees - Service fees for chimney inspection services generally fall between $80 and $250. The final cost can vary based on the size of the chimney and the level of inspection required by local pros.
Additional Charges - Extra charges may apply for comprehensive inspections or specialized testing, which can add $50 to $150 to the overall cost. For instance, a chimney draft test or video scan might be billed separately.
Cost Factors - The cost of chimney inspections can fluctuate based on the location, chimney type, and service provider. In Burleson, TX, prices typically align with regional averages, but complex or older chimney systems may incur higher fees.

What is involved in a chimney inspection service? A chimney inspection typically includes examining the chimney structure, checking for obstructions, creosote buildup, and assessing the overall condition of the chimney and flue system.
How often should I schedule a chimney inspection? It is recommended to have a chimney inspection at least once a year, especially before the heating season begins or after any significant weather events.
What are the signs that my chimney needs an inspection? Visible cracks, soot or creosote buildup, odors, smoke backup, or poor draft are indicators that a chimney inspection may be necessary.
